le 21/11/2009 à 00:42
Insert into...values...select ...from
Merci globule effectivement, il y a du changement..mais j'aurai voulu les valeurs des champs...
Un values est à mettre, mais là..
Un values est à mettre, mais là..
<?php INSERT INTO `films` (`id` ,`name` ,`synopsys` ,`annee` ,`genre` ,`cover` ,`lien` ,`dateajout` ,`bannonce`) SELECT VALUES ('id', 'name', 'synopsys', 'annee', 'genre', 'cover', 'lien','','') FROM `film`
php ?>
<?
include("../config.php");
include("../functions.php");
include("secure.php");
connexiondb();
est_vide($sujet, 'Le champ Sujet n\'est pas renseigné !');
est_vide($message, 'Le champ Message n\'est pas renseigné !');
$texte=$message;
if($page==""){$page=0;}
$limit="5000";
$debut=$page*$limit;
$requete=mysql_query("select distinct(email) from $db_table WHERE valide='1'");
$nb_total=mysql_num_rows($requete);
$requete=mysql_query("select distinct(email),nom,prenom,passwd,login from $db_table WHERE valide='1' LIMIT $debut,$limit");
$nombre=mysql_num_rows($requete);
$sujet=str_replace("#quot#","\"",$sujet);
$texte=str_replace("#quot#","\"",$texte);
$sujet=stripslashes($sujet);
$texte=stripslashes($texte);
$i=0;
$tmp=$debut+$limit;
$a=$tmp-$limit+1;
echo "<table align=\"center\">\n";
if($html=="1") {
$texte = ereg_replace("\n", "<br>", $texte);
}
$i=0;
while ($i<$nombre)
{
$To=mysql_result($requete,$i,"email");
$nom=mysql_result($requete,$i,"nom");
$prenom=mysql_result($requete,$i,"prenom");
$pass=mysql_result($requete,$i,"passwd");
$login=mysql_result($requete,$i,"login");
$texte=ereg_replace("#email#", "$To", $texte);
$texte=ereg_replace("#login#", "$login", $texte);
$texte=ereg_replace("#pass#", "$pass", $texte);
$texte=ereg_replace("#nom#", "$nom", $texte);
$texte=ereg_replace("#prenom#", "$prenom", $texte);
$test="Erreur : Mail non envoyé";
if($html=="1") { if(mail($To, "[Membres] ".$sujet, "$texte<br><br>----------------------------------<br>Ceci n'est pas une newsletter, juste un message envoyé aux membres du site.<br><a href='http://www.days-media.fr'>Days-media.fr , le site de streaming en haute qualité</a>", "From: $nomsite <$mailmaster>\nX-Mailer: Mailingliste\nContent-Type: text/html;charset=\"iso-8859-1\"")) {$test="Mail envoyé au format html.";} }
if($html=="0") { if(mail($To, "[Membres] ".$sujet, "$texte\n\n----------------------------------\nCeci n'est pas une newsletter, juste un message envoyé aux membres du site.\nhttp://www.days-media.fr", "From: $nomsite <$mailmaster>")) {$test="Mail envoyé au format texte.";} }
echo "<tr><td><font size=1><b>$a-</b> </font>$To</td><td><b>$test</b></td></tr>\n";
$texte=ereg_replace("$To", "#email#", $texte);
$texte=ereg_replace("$login", "#login#", $texte);
$texte=ereg_replace("$pass", "#pass#", $texte);
$texte=ereg_replace("$nom", "#nom#", $texte);
$texte=ereg_replace("$prenom", "#prenom#", $texte);
$i++; $a++;
}
echo "</table>\n";
$tmp=$debut+$limit;
if($tmp>$nb_total) {$tmp=$nb_total;}
echo "<br><br><b>$tmp</b> mails envoyés sur <b>$nb_total</b> !<br><br>";
$sujet=str_replace("\"","#quot#",$sujet);
$texte=str_replace("\"","#quot#",$texte);
if($debut+$limit<$nb_total)
{
$suivant=$page+1;
echo "<form action=\"send.php\" method=\"post\">
<input type=\"hidden\" name=\"page\" value=\"$suivant\">
<input type=\"hidden\" name=\"sujet\" value=\"$sujet\">
<input type=\"hidden\" name=\"message\" value=\"$texte\">
<input type=\"hidden\" name=\"html\" value=\"$html\">
<input type=\"submit\" value=\"Continuer\"> <input type=\"button\" value=\"Arrêter\" OnClick=\"window.close();\">
</form>";
}
else {echo "<a href=\"javascript:window.close();\">Quitter</a>";}
mysql_close();
?>
<?php echo " </td></tr><TR>";
echo " <TD align='left' class=\"lasaisie\">";
echo " Lien :</td><td class=\"lasaisie\">";
echo " <INPUT TYPE='text' NAME='url' VALUE='/annonces/lien_à_générer.php' SIZE=50 MAXLENGTH=50 class=\"select\">";
echo " </TD>";
echo " </TR>";
php ?>